Synopsis

Break No Bones is a book by Kathy Reichs, published in 2006 and featuring forensic anthropologist Dr. Temperance Brennan. The plot centers around her students working on a site of prehistoric graves on Dewees, a barrier island, when a decomposing body is uncovered in a shallow grave off a lonely beach. Brennan (nicknamed Tempe) is then called upon to discover what is happening when other bodies begin showing up all around the Charleston area.
